Output e3750a7d10c312debec94fbae013319462122b350492d3bace3f3248f1164fbc:37

value
290204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 beaf52d9a7794cd68e3ae7739670d1759475efb5 OP_EQUAL
address
3K5GLh3JwnQrDDVSDc4VkHuEXFZhUjzoF2
transaction
e3750a7d10c312debec94fbae013319462122b350492d3bace3f3248f1164fbc
spent
true